Does Kratom Cause High Blood Pressure? A Detailed Look
Kratom, a natural herb derived from the Mitragyna speciosa plant, has gained popularity for its various potential therapeutic effects, including its ability to enhance endurance through training. However, one common concern among users is whether kratom can cause high blood pressure (BP). It’s essential to understand that while some individuals may experience elevated BP after consuming kratom, it’s not universally experienced and the scientific evidence is mixed.
Studies have shown that kratom’s primary effects on cardiovascular systems are complex and context-dependent. While some users report feeling a mild increase in blood pressure, others experience relaxation and reduced stress levels, which can actually lower BP. The impact of kratom on BP seems to be influenced by various factors such as dosage, strain type, individual tolerance, and underlying health conditions. Therefore, those considering using kratom for endurance training should monitor their BP regularly and consult with healthcare professionals, especially if they have pre-existing hypertension or other cardiovascular issues.
